What is the difference between Seborin Hair Tonic and Alpecin Caffeine Liquid Hair Tonic?
Seborin Hair Tonic is formulated with active ingredients like Pro-Vitamin B5 and wheat proteins to nourish and strengthen the hair, while Alpecin Caffeine Liquid Hair Tonic contains caffeine to stimulate hair roots and promote hair growth. Seborin Hair Tonic focuses on overall hair health and vitality, while Alpecin Caffeine Liquid Hair Tonic specifically targets hair loss and thinning. Both products can improve the condition of the hair, but they have different primary functions based on their ingredients.

How can Alpecin Caffeine Shampoo lead to faster hair growth?
Alpecin Caffeine Shampoo can lead to faster hair growth due to its caffeine content, which has been shown to stimulate hair follicles and promote hair growth. Caffeine can penetrate the scalp and help increase blood circulation to the hair follicles, which in turn can promote hair growth. Additionally, the shampoo also contains other ingredients that can help strengthen the hair and reduce hair loss, leading to overall healthier and faster-growing hair.

What is hair tonic?
Hair tonic is a grooming product that is applied to the hair and scalp to promote hair growth, strengthen hair follicles, and improve overall hair health. It often contains ingredients like vitamins, minerals, and herbal extracts that nourish the hair and stimulate blood circulation to the scalp. Hair tonic can also help to reduce dandruff, prevent hair loss, and add shine and volume to the hair.

What stimulates hair growth?
Hair growth is primarily stimulated by the hair follicles, which are tiny structures in the skin that produce hair. Factors such as genetics, hormones, diet, and overall health can influence the rate of hair growth. Additionally, regular scalp massages, proper hair care, and a balanced diet rich in vitamins and minerals can also promote healthy hair growth. Lastly, certain medications and treatments, such as minoxidil and laser therapy, can help stimulate hair growth in individuals experiencing hair loss.

"Is hair growth realistic?"
Yes, hair growth is realistic and a natural process that occurs in the human body. Hair grows in cycles, with each hair follicle going through a growth phase, a resting phase, and a shedding phase. The rate of hair growth can vary from person to person, but on average, hair grows about half an inch per month. There are also various factors that can affect hair growth, such as genetics, age, and overall health. While there are products and treatments that claim to promote hair growth, it's important to be cautious and consult with a healthcare professional before trying any new products or treatments.

Does straightening hair affect hair growth?
Straightening hair using heat tools can damage the hair shaft, leading to breakage and split ends. This damage can make the hair appear thinner and less healthy, but it does not directly affect the hair growth from the follicle. However, if the hair is constantly damaged from straightening, it may appear as though the hair is not growing as quickly or as thickly as it should. It is important to use heat protectant products and limit the use of heat styling tools to maintain healthy hair growth.
